Headboard Storage Assembly
A headboard storage assembly includes a headboard that may be mounted on a support surface thereby facilitating the headboard to be aligned with a bed. A pair of first pockets is provided and each of the first pockets is coupled the headboard for storing objects. A pair of second pockets is each coupled the headboard for storing objects. A first door is hingedly coupled to the headboard and a first display is coupled to the first door to insertably receive an electronic device. Thus, the first display facilitates hands-free use of the electronic device for a user lying on the bed. A second door is hingedly coupled to the headboard and a second display is coupled to the second door. The second display insertably receives an electronic device thereby facilitating hands-free use of the electronic device for the user lying on the bed.

A pair of first pockets 28 is each coupled the headboard 12 for storing objects. Each of the first pockets 28 is positioned on the second surface 20 of the headboard 12 and each of the first pockets 28 has a top end 30. The top end 30 corresponding to each of the first pockets 28 is open to access an interior of the corresponding first pocket 28. A pair of second pockets 32 is each coupled the headboard 12 for storing objects. Each of the second pockets 32 is positioned on the second surface 20 of the headboard 12 and each of the second pockets 32 has a top end 34. The top end 34 corresponding to each of the second pockets 32 is open to access an interior of the corresponding second pocket 32.
A plurality of first mating members 36 is provided and each of the first mating members 36 is coupled to the second surface 20 of the headboard 12. A first door 38 is hingedly coupled to the headboard 12. The first door 38 is selectively positioned in a stored position having the first door 38 lying on the headboard 12. Additionally, the first door 38 is selectively positioned in a deployed position having the first door 38 being positioned at an angle with the headboard 12.
The first door 38 has a first edge 40, a first surface 42 and a second surface 44. The first edge 40 is hingedly coupled to the first lateral side 24 of the headboard 12. Moreover, the first surface 42 of the first door 38 abuts the second surface 20 of the headboard 12 when the first door 38 is in the stored position. A first cushion 46 is coupled to the second surface 20 of the first door 38 and the first cushion 46 completely covers the second surface 20 of the first door 38.
A first display 48 is coupled to the first door 38 and the first display 48 insertably receives an electronic device 49, such as a smart phone, an ipad and other electronic device 49 that has an electronic display. The first display 48 facilitates hands-free use of the electronic device 49 for a user lying on the bed 16. The first display 48 is positioned on the first surface 18 of the first door 38 and the first display 48 is comprised of a translucent material. The first display 48 may comprise a plexiglass box or the like and the first display 48 may have a slot therein for receiving the electronic device 49.
A third pocket 50 is coupled to the first surface 42 of the first door 38 for storing headphones and other objects. A second mating member 52 is coupled to the first surface 18 of the first door 38. The second mating member 52 releasably engages an associated one of the first mating members 36 when the first door 38 is positioned in the stored position to retain the first door 38 and the stored position. Each of the first mating members 36 and the second mating member 52 may be a hook and loop fastener or the like.
A second door 54 is hingedly coupled to the headboard 12. The second door 54 is selectively positioned in a stored position having the second door 54 lying on the headboard 12. The second door 54 is selectively positioned in a deployed position having the second door 54 being positioned at an angle with the headboard 12. The second door 54 has a first edge 56, a first surface 58 and a second surface 60 and the first edge 56 of the second door 54 is hingedly coupled to the second lateral side 26 of the headboard 12. The first surface 58 of the second door 54 abuts the second surface 20 of the headboard 12 when the second door 54 is in the stored position. A second cushion 62 is coupled to the second surface 60 of the second door 54 and the second cushion 62 completely covers the second surface of the second door 54.
A second display 64 is coupled to the second door 54 and the second display 64 insertably receives an electronic device 49 thereby facilitating hands-free use of the electronic device 49. The second display 64 is positioned on the first surface 58 of the second door 54 and the second display 64 is comprised of a translucent material. The second display 64 may comprise a plexiglass box or the like and the second display 64 may have a slot therein for receiving the electronic device 49.
A fourth pocket 66 is coupled to the first surface 18 of the second door 54 for storing headphones and other objects. A third mating member 68 is coupled to the first surface 18 of the second door 54 and the third mating member 68 releasably engages an associated one of the first mating members 36 when the second door 54 is positioned in the stored position to retain the second door 54 in the stored position. The third mating member 68 may comprise a hook and loop fastener or the like.
A first input 70 is coupled to the headboard 12 the electronic device 49 is selectively electrically coupled to the first input 70. The first input 70 is positioned on the first lateral side 24 of the headboard 12 and the first input 70 comprises a plurality of usb ports or the like. A second input 72 is coupled to the headboard 12 and the electronic device 49 is selectively electrically coupled to the second input 72. The second input 72 is positioned on the second lateral side 26 of the headboard 12 and the second input 72 comprising a plurality of usb ports or the like.
A pair of speakers 74 is provided and each of the speakers 74 is coupled to the headboard 12 for emitting audible sounds. Each of the speakers 74 is electrically coupled to the first input 70 and the second input 72 to receive an audio signal from the electronic device 49. Each of the speakers 74 is embedded in the second surface 20 of the headboard 12 and each of the speakers 74 may be Bluetooth speakers 74 or the like for wireless communication with the electronic device 49.
A power supply 76 is coupled to the headboard 12 and the power supply 76 is electrically coupled each of the first input 70 and the second input 72 to charge the electronic device 49. The power supply 76 comprises a power cord 78 extending outwardly from the headboard 12 and the power cord 78 has a distal end 80 with respect to the headboard 12. A plug 82 is electrically coupled to the distal end 80 and the plug 82 is electrically coupled to a power source 84, such as a female electrical outlet or the like.
In use, the headboard 12 is mounted on the wall and the bed 16 is aligned with the headboard 12. The first door 38 is selectively opened to expose the first display 48 and the second door 54 is selectively opened to expose the second display 64. The electronic device 49 is positioned in a selected one of the first 48 and second 64 displays for hands-free use of the electronic device 49. In this way the user may lay in bed 16 while watching a movie or the like on the electronic device 49. The electronic device 49 is selectively plugged into the first 70 or second 72 input to charge the electronic device 49 and to send audio from the electronic device 49 through the speakers 74.
